Job description

Occupational Therapist (OT)

German Centre at Deutsches Altenheim located in West Roxbury, MA, is a skilled nursing residence and post-acute care provider that consistently delivers high-quality, compassionate care while focusing on the development of innovative programs and services that enable individuals to live as independently as possible. We are seeking an Occupational Therapist (OT) to join the Deutsches Altenheim team at the German Centre and support our residents.

Position Summary :

As a member of our Therapy Team, the Occupational Therapist (OT) provides caring and compassionate services to our residents and initiates referrals when appropriate and in accordance with department procedures.

Duties :

  • Provide kind and compassionate care to our residents.
  • Conduct screenings of residents as directed by the Director of Rehabilitation to determine need for intervention / treatment.
  • Coordinate treatment plan with residents, family, and other team members.
  • Develop appropriate home or community programming to maintain and enhance the performance of the resident in their own environment.

Qualifications :

  • Bachelor of Science in Occupational Therapy from an accredited program.
  • Current Massachusetts licensure.
  • Excellent communication skills, both verbal, written, and electronic.
  • Experience in Geriatrics or home care is preferred.
  • Successful completion of National Certification Examination for OTR.
  • Maintains educational competency as required by state and federal regulations.
  • Ability to adjust to new or changing situations and stresses.
  • Must be able to reach with hands and arms, balance, lift and perform medium to maximum transfer assists with residents.
